[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
03C129620
03C129620B
03D129620
074129620A
13278257
13319421
1378078K00
1654670J10
2811307100
2S6U11000CA
or
Post Buying Request
Suppliers
BLUE PRINT
ADT39340
Find The OE Number:
16571-26060
NPS
T157A39
Find The Comparable Number:
1657126060